Windsor Cup 2023: Preview & How To Watch Live

14 August 2023

The first PSA World Tour event of the new season gets underway tomorrow from Canada as round one of the Windsor Cup commences from the Devonshire Mall in Windsor, Ontario.

The PSA World Tour Bronze event will feature 24 men, who will all be looking to start their 2023/24 campaigns in strong style and claim valuable World Tour points to boost their rankings in the season-opening event. Eight matches will take place on day one, with play starting at 13:00 (GMT-4) on the all-glass court.

Egypt’s former World Champion Tarek Momen tops the draw as he looks to win his first event since February 2020. A win which also came in Canada at the Toronto Cup where he overcame Paul Coll in a straight games victory. Compatriot Youssef Soliman is the No.2 seed for the event and will be determined to start the season the same way he did the last, as he claimed a win at the CIB ZED Open.

Japan’s Ryonuske Tsukue will take on USA’s Todd Harrity in the opening match of day one. The Japanese No.1 will be featuring in his first World Tour event whilst Harrity will be playing in his 82nd. Despite Harrity’s experience Tsukue put together some strong performances at the end of last season, meaning that it won’t be easy for the American to progress.

Another close match is anticipated in that quarter of the draw as Scotland’s Rory Stewart will face Colombia’s Juan Camilo Vargas. Stewart sits 11 places ahead of Vargas in the latest PSA rankings but it was the Colombian who scored the latest win as he overcame the Scot in the Bermuda Open 2022, coming from 2-1 down to win in 75 minutes.

Aside from the top two seeds mentioned earlier, the rest of the top eight will enter the fray on day two with the likes of Greg Lobban, Abdulla Al Tamimi and Leonel Cardenas due to face difficult opposition.
